The Ultimate List for a Successful Tune-Up of Your Lawn Sprinkler



Maintaining your sprinkler system is necessary for a healthy and balanced grass and efficient water usage. What specific actions should you take to guarantee your system runs smoothly?


Examine Sprinkler Heads for Damages and Obstructions



Before you switch on your lawn sprinkler for the season, it's vital to check the lawn sprinkler heads for any type of damage or blockages. Begin by checking each head visually. Look for cracks, breaks, or any signs of wear that can influence their efficiency. Next off, remove any type of debris, such as dirt or turf, that may be obstructing the nozzles. You'll want to ensure that water can stream easily when the system activates.


If you discover any blocked heads, remove them and saturate them in a service of vinegar and water to liquify mineral deposits. Taking these actions will aid ensure your lawn sprinkler system operates efficiently throughout the season.


Readjust and check Lawn sprinkler Coverage



After validating your lawn sprinkler heads are tidy and in good problem, it's time to check and change the insurance coverage they supply. Walk your lawn while the system is running and observe the spray patterns. See to it each area is obtaining adequate water without overspray onto walkways or driveways. Change the angle of the lawn sprinkler heads if required; you can normally turn them to redirect the water flow.


For areas that get too much water, reduced the heads or readjust the span settings if your sprinklers have that attribute. Taking the time to make improvements these changes will certainly guarantee your yard and garden get the best amount of water, promoting healthy and balanced development throughout the period.

Examine the Controller and Timers



Examining the controller and timers of your lawn sprinkler is important for maintaining an effective watering timetable. Begin by examining the setups on your controller. See to it the day and time are proper; this assurances your system runs as intended. Next off, evaluate the watering routine to verify it straightens with your landscape design demands and regional weather problems.


Run a manual test cycle for each and every area to verify it turns on correctly. Watch for any type of malfunctions or hold-ups, as these could show concerns needing interest. Readjust the run times and regularity if you see any zones more than- or under-watered.


Additionally, acquaint on your own with the rainfall delay attribute if your controller has one; it helps conserve water throughout wet durations. Frequently testing your controller and timers not only conserves water however also promotes much healthier plants and a lively landscape.


Tidy Filters and Displays



Frequently cleaning displays and filters is crucial for keeping your lawn sprinkler working effectively. Gradually, dust, mineral, and particles build-up can clog these components, resulting in uneven water circulation and lowered efficiency. Beginning by locating the filters and screens in your system, which are commonly found at the main line and private lawn sprinkler heads.


As soon as you have actually determined them, transform off the water system and thoroughly remove each filter or screen. Rinse them under running water to remove any type of buildup. For persistent down payments, make use of a soft brush and moderate cleaning agent, but prevent rough chemicals that can damage the components.


After cleansing, reassemble everything and double-check for any type see this website of visible wear or damages. If you discover anything uncommon, think about replacing the filters or displays to guarantee peak efficiency - Sprinkler diagnostic. By preserving tidy filters and screens, you'll help your automatic sprinkler run smoothly and efficiently

Examine Stress Scale



One important facet of preserving your sprinkler system is checking the pressure scale to confirm perfect water pressure. You should frequently check this scale, as appropriate pressure warranties your system runs successfully. Look for the advised stress array, typically between 30 to 50 PSI, depending on your system's specifications. If the reading's too low, your sprinklers will not disperse water effectively, leading to dry spots. Conversely, high pressure can cause damages to your system and uneven watering. Take note of them if you notice any kind of discrepancies. Doing this basic check can conserve you time and money, and maintain your backyard healthy and environment-friendly. Make it a practice to examine the gauge at the beginning of each period for optimum performance.

Frequently Asked Concerns



Just how Commonly Should I Execute a Tune-Up on My Sprinkler System?



You should carry out a tune-up on your automatic sprinkler a minimum of yearly, preferably before the growing period. Routine upkeep helps guarantee performance, stops leaks, and keeps your yard healthy and hydrated throughout the year.


Can I Do a Tune-Up Myself or Employ a Specialist?



You can definitely do a tune-up yourself if you're helpful and have the right devices. Nevertheless, working with self timer watering system a specialist guarantees everything's done appropriately, which could save you time and prospective headaches down the line.


What Devices Do I Need for an Automatic Sprinkler Tune-Up?



You'll need a couple of essential tools for your automatic sprinkler tune-up: a screwdriver, pliers, a wrench, a garden hose, and a timer. Having these helpful will make your tune-up process smoother and a lot more effective.


Are There Seasonal Factors To Consider for Lawn Sprinkler Upkeep?



Yes, there are seasonal considerations for preserving your lawn sprinkler. You'll wish to change sprinkling schedules based on temperature level changes, get ready for winter months by draining pipes, and assurance appropriate coverage throughout springtime growth.


Exactly How Can I Boost Water Efficiency in My Automatic Sprinkler?



To boost water performance in your lawn sprinkler, change the sprinkling timetable based upon climate condition, mount drip watering, utilize rain sensors, and consistently check for obstructions or leakages to assure peak performance.
